A lot of people like the Trident cases. I'm especially excited for the Kraken AMS, which has loads of accessories (car mounts, bike clips, etc). Trident seems to develop a wider range of cases for their phones, all of which are cheaper than the lower end otterbox.
The main advantage with Otterbox is the plastic screen cover, which is built into the case. This is a hit-or-miss, depending on the preference. For me, it is a big miss because dust will invariably get in behind the screen (especially if you work construction like me), forcing you to remove the case to clean the phone on nearly a weekly basis. After a while of taking the case on and off, the soft outer shell will lose its tension, and will start to flop off when you don't want it to. This has been a constant design flaw with Otterbox.
The other thing Otterbox has going for it is the full size holster. I use the holster all the time, so this used to be a plus. The problem is that the hard plastic clip is prone to breaking.
I now go with the Trident Kraken and SpiGen protector. I don't use the included belt clip, and instead I use a full pouch which fits the phone case and all. This has worked well for my Nexus, and should work well for the GN2 as well.
It is a matter of preference though. This is only my opinion, and lots of people are quite happy with Otterbox.

Belkin Snap Folio Case

After cracking the screen on my Note 2 with a very short less than 2 foot drop I decided I needed to upgrade the protection on my phone. I had a Cruzerlite on there and I thought that was about as good as you could get until you started getting into the big bulky dual and triple layer cases. After looking over my options I picked up the Belkin Snap Folio case at a Verizon store today. Lots of things I like about it and a couple of things I don't. I wasn't sure I would like a folio style case as I think the cover would be a PITA. After a whole day I'm getting used too it, not saying I'm loving the flip open style case but it is growing on me. It does add some thickness to the phone, not as bad as a Defender or the like but more so that my TPU case. It is a little more difficult to pull out of my bluejeans (Levis slim cut) pocket because of the size, the soft leather body which is grippier, and the snap tab which will grab the edge of the pocket. I don''t know if thi will go away with some use but the snap closure curls up when it is used as a stand and obstructs the phone. Hopefully this will go away as I work and break in the leather. There is an indention for the home button on the cover so it lessens the chance of accidental presses waking the device. The leather is soft and the case has a good high quality feel too it. Although it does feel like a quality product don't confuse that for the feel of a premium product you will get some some of the more expensive leather cases available on the market.

There is a hard rubberized plastic shell that is fused to the inside of the leather folio case. I like this design because of the way all 4 corners are protected. The thick still leather body also adds quite a bit of protection and will help absorb the energy of a fall. I also like the security of the cover protecting the glass during a fall. My wife broke her GSII when it fell and hit a pebble sticking up out of the grass. The fit is perfect and all ports like up exactly. With the case closed you have access to the power button, USB port, and headset port. The headset port looks like it is partially blocked but that isn't the case. It is unobstructed and you will have no problems fitting any headphones. My Westones which usually have a hard time fitting into any case unmodified have no problems with this case.
